FARGO, N.D., 鈥 North Dakota State University announced today the establishment and launch of a transformative, interdisciplinary research institute focused in areas of global innovation, trade and economic growth thanks to leadership philanthropy from Sheila and Robert Challey, the Charles Koch Foundation and other benefactors.

Initial gifts of more than $30 million have been secured, already resulting in the largest collection of philanthropic support focused solely on supporting faculty and student scholarship in institutional history. The institute has a goal of raising $50 million for up to 15 years of programming, which will catalyze new discovery, learning, and service to the state, region and world.

 Complex challenges being explored by major research universities today are often at the intersection of academic disciplines, and the institute will draw from numerous programs to encourage study of questions such as: how do global innovation, trade and institutions advance human potential?; how do structural barriers limit full participation and advancement in economies?; how different policies impact diverse communities in the region and throughout the U.S. economy?; and what role does technology play in broadening innovation?

The new initiative is named in honor of longtime 六合彩投注网 benefactors, Sheila and Robert Challey, of Walnut Creek, Calif. The Challeys have provided a leadership gift commitment of $10 million. Known as the 鈥Sheila and Robert Challey Institute for Global Innovation and Growth,鈥 the program will be administered through 六合彩投注网鈥檚 College of Business.

The Challey Institute will support the hiring of an executive director and provide funding for up to 15 faculty positions in a variety of fields including economics, engineering, education, entrepreneurship, finance, political science, public policy and sociology. New Ph.D. and graduate fellowships will be offered to students from a range of academic disciplines, and experiential learning opportunities for undergraduate students will be launched. Faculty exchanges, speaker series and outreach activities will bolster the institute鈥檚 impact in bringing together students, faculty, business and community leaders to address real problems and identify topics where the Challey Institute can make a significant contribution.

Scott Beaulier, the Ronald and Kaye Olson Dean of Business at 六合彩投注网, said the intellectual inspiration for the Challey Institute comes from the late Dr. Mancur Olson, a 1954 graduate of 六合彩投注网. Mancur grew up on a farm east of Buxton, N.D., that his grandfather homesteaded in the late 1870s. Following additional education as a Rhodes Scholar, at Oxford and Harvard, he went on to become a professor of economics at the University of Maryland-College Park, and was widely considered one of the most influential economists and thought leaders in his discipline. Through his scholarship, he asked questions, such as: 鈥淲hy are some countries rich and others poor? And, why is it that everyone worldwide is entrepreneurial, yet only a few parts of the world are prosperous?鈥 After his unfortunate death in 1998, the Economist magazine noted, 鈥溾 his theories might well have won him a Nobel Prize.鈥 Olson received the 1989 Alumni Achievement Award from 六合彩投注网.

The Charles Koch Foundation, with a gift commitment of $10 million, and other benefactors are partnering with the Challeys to make the institute possible. The Charles Koch Foundation supports scholars, students, and partners developing creative solutions that will help people transform their lives, achieve their potential, and make the world a better place for all.

Sheila and Robert Challey鈥檚 involvement with 六合彩投注网 dates back generations, with Robert鈥檚 parents, Clyde and Myrtle Challey, both graduating from the university. Myrtle Challey taught food and nutrition classes on campus, and Robert鈥檚 uncle was Bill Euren, director of the Gold Star Band from 1948-1968. After receiving a chemistry degree from 六合彩投注网, Robert completed graduated school at University of California-Berkeley and has had a successful career in California real estate development. In 1981, he joined the 六合彩投注网 Foundation as a trustee and currently serves on its Executive Governing Board. Robert received an Alumni Achievement Award in 1986, the Foundation鈥檚 Service Award in 2002 and an honorary doctorate from 六合彩投注网 in 2009. Sheila and Robert support scholarships in performing arts, facility projects and many other campus initiatives. The Challey School of Music is also named in their honor, recognizing support for one of their favorite passions. They have three adult children.

The Challeys are volunteer co-chairs of 六合彩投注网鈥檚 comprehensive fundraising campaign, currently in its advanced gifts phase. The campaign aims to significantly grow support for all areas of the university, but with a special emphasis on new investments to impact faculty and students. The campaign will publicly launch later this fall.
